












Abstract:This paper proposes the Trajectory-Information Exchange Multi-Bernoulli (T-IEMB) filter to estimate sets of alive and all trajectories in track-before-detect applications with nested superpositional measurements. This measurement model has a nested architecture with two layers. The first layer includes superpositional hidden variables which are then mapped in the second layer to the conditional mean and covariance of the measurement, enabling it to model a broad range of measurement models. This paper also presents a Gaussian implementation of the T-IEMB filter, which performs the update by approximating the conditional moments of the measurement model, a computationally light filtering solution. Simulation results for a non-Gaussian radar-based tracking scenario demonstrate the performance of two Gaussian T-IEMB implementations, which provide improved tracking performance compared to state-of-the-art particle filters for track-before-detect, at a reduced computational cost.
